Family | ARISTOLOCHIACEAE |
Genus species | Asarum asaroides (C.Morren & Decne.) Makino |
Synonyms | Heterotropa asaroides C.Morren & Decne. |
Habitat | thickets and woods |
Description | leaves broadly ovate to deltoid-ovate, 8-12cm long, long petiolate, obtuse, adaxially on veinlets pubescent, below glabrous, flowers shortly pedicellate, glabrous, 2-3cm long |
Size | 10-15cm |
Color | purple |
Bloom | spring, summer |
Ca | |
Type | carpet |
Cultivation | cold, shady site with a humous, moist soil alpine house, moist, humous soil, shade |
Propagation | seed when ripe or as soon as possible division in early and late summer |
Territory |
Asia-Temperate
Eastern Asia (Japan) |
